Goods & Services Tax (GST) Guide
The Goods and Services Tax (GST) is a destination-based, multi-stage indirect tax structure levied on the supply of goods and services. Since its introduction, it has consolidated multiple state and central taxes into a unified single-tax regime, improving market efficiency.
Intrastate vs. Interstate Tax Division
GST is classified based on where the seller and buyer are located:
- Intrastate Sales (Within State): The GST tax is divided equally into CGST (Central GST) and SGST (State GST). For example, an 18% GST rate translates to 9% CGST and 9% SGST.
- Interstate Sales (Across States): A single consolidated tax called IGST (Integrated GST) is charged, which goes entirely to the Central Government to be redistributed.
How to Add GST (Tax Exclusive)
If your product price does not include tax, you calculate the tax to be added:
GST Tax Amount = Base Price × (GST Rate / 100)
Gross Price = Base Price + GST Tax Amount

How to Remove GST (Tax Inclusive)
If the retail price already includes GST and you want to extract the base net price:
Net Base Price = Gross Price × [100 / (100 + GST Rate)]
GST Tax Amount = Gross Price - Net Base Price
